Position Overview:
The Non-Technical Program Coordinator provides essential administrative and project coordination support for cross-functional initiatives across OCHIN. This role supports the planning, execution, and tracking of internal programs and processes, ensuring efficient scheduling, documentation, and communication. The Non-Technical Program Coordinator plays a key role in maintaining smooth workflows and helping align departmental activities with organizational priorities.
Essential Functions:
- Serve as a point of contact for internal stakeholders, ensuring effective communication and collaboration across departments.
- Prepare and distribute reports, summaries, and internal communications to support program execution and interdepartmental coordination.
- Maintain accurate documentation of program activities, updates, and outcomes using internal tracking systems and tools.
- Collaborate with team members to track project milestones, ensuring timely completion of tasks and follow-ups.
- Support process improvement initiatives by documenting workflows, identifying inefficiencies, and recommending enhancements.
